Implementing the 2030 Agenda at urban level: Analysis of policy styles in Latin America and Europe
The inclusion of Sustainable Development Goal 11 (SDG11) in the 2030 Agenda represents a significant policy shift in how urban challenges are addressed and sustainable development is promoted in cities. This orientation was reinforced by the 2016 Quito Declaration, which set the foundation for the New Urban Agenda (NUA), outlining a global framework for urban policy and intervention. Since then, numerous initiatives have emerged to incorporate SDGs into urban policies, including the development of National Urban Policies (NUPs) and the use of indicators to assess the implementation of SDGs in urban areas.
This paper examines how SDGs have been integrated into the urban policy frameworks of Mexico, Chile, Italy, and Brazil, highlighting the ways in which the 2030 Agenda has influenced urban policies and shaped policy styles across different regions. To explore these dynamics, we develop an analytical framework that identifies the policy styles emerging from the application of the 2030 Agenda in each case analysed.
